Parkkima, Pyhäjärvi

Parkkima is a large, currently unzoned area located near Lake Pyhäjärvi, offering strong potential for electricity‑intensive industrial operations. The site’s proximity to the railway and the planned new power grid infrastructure provide a solid foundation for long‑term development.

Area description

Project Parkkima consists of a 100-hectare area located 10 km from Pyhäjärvi and 160 km from Kokkola, with the nearest residential area about 1.5 km from the site. A railway line runs south to the project site.

The site is not yet zoned. We are developing the area in cooperation with the City of Pyhäjärvi.

Given the proximity to Pyhäjärvi, excess heat sales opportunities could be explored.

The Murtoperä 400 kV substation is to be built about 15 km from the project site (expected by 2032), with a grid capacity of c. 2-3 GW.

The Lahdenperä substation operated by Fingrid is planned to be located along the transmission corridor approximately 10 km to the west, towards Haapajärvi. Its environmental impact assessment (EIA) is currently underway.

Another data center initiative is undergoing zoning in the area, but grid capacity is expected to be sufficient for both projects. A grid connection agreement could be ready for signing in 2029.

There are several renewable energy projects in the vicinity of the area.
